EMD (Earnest Money Deposit) requirements vary from ₹1K to ₹4.1 lakh, depending on the tender value and project scope. The EMD is typically 1-3% of the estimated contract value and must be submitted in the form of demand draft, banker's cheque, or bank guarantee.
Zilla Panchayat primarily conducts procurement through the Central Public Procurement Portal (CPPP) and the Government e-Marketplace (GeM). Some tenders may also be published on state-specific e-procurement portals and the Zilla Panchayat official website. It's important to regularly monitor these platforms and register on them to access tender documents and participate in the bidding process.
To register as a vendor for Zilla Panchayat tenders, you need to: 1) Create an account on relevant e-procurement portals (CPPP, GeM), 2) Complete your vendor profile with company details, 3) Upload required documents (GST registration, PAN, certificates), 4) Obtain digital signature certificate (DSC), 5) Complete any Zilla Panchayat-specific registration requirements. Ensure all certifications and licenses relevant to your business are valid and up to date.
Common documents required include: GST registration certificate, PAN card, company incorporation certificate, digital signature certificate (DSC), bank solvency certificate, EMD payment proof, experience certificates from previous projects, audited financial statements (last 3 years), and technical qualification documents. Specific tenders may require additional certifications, licenses, or compliance documents as mentioned in the tender notice.
Success in Zilla Panchayat tenders depends on several factors: competitive and realistic pricing, complete technical compliance with specifications, relevant past experience and successful project completion records, timely submission before deadlines, complete and accurate documentation, strong financial standing, understanding of Zilla Panchayat's procurement guidelines and evaluation criteria, and building a track record of quality delivery. It's also beneficial to attend pre-bid meetings when offered.
